Energy balance
High energy flux (matching high caloric intake with high expenditure via physical activity) is superior to low energy flux for maintaining energy balance and preventing obesity, as it allows for better appetite regulation and avoids the metabolic adaptations associated with caloric restriction.
To manage your weight effectively, focus on increasing your 'energy flux' rather than just restricting calories. This means combining a healthy diet with regular physical activity. High energy flux allows your body to better regulate appetite and metabolism, making it easier to maintain a healthy weight compared to sedentary individuals who rely solely on severe dietary restriction.
Mayer et al postulated that individuals with a high rate of energy flow through the body (ie, high intake matched by high expenditure) were better able to maintain energy balance than those with a low rate of energy expenditure... He referred to a moderate and high energy flux as the regulated zone where energy intake was well matched to level of energy expenditure (eg, better appetite control).

The paper is an editorial citing observational studies and theoretical models (Mayer, Blundell) rather than presenting new primary RCT data.
